Check whether the following are quadratic equations : (i) `(x-2)^2+1=2x-3` (ii) `x(x+1)+8=(x+2)(x 2)`(iii) `x(2x+3)=x^2+1` (iv) `(x+2)^3=x^3-4` |
|
Answer» (i) `(x-2)^2+1 = 2x-3` `=>x^2+4-4x+1 = 2x-3` `=>x^2-6x+8 = 0` As coefficient of `x^2` is not `0`, so it is a quadratic equation. (ii)`x(x+1)+8 = (x+2)(x-2)` `=>x^2+x+8 = x^2-4` `=>x+12 = 0` As coefficient of `x^2` is `0`, so it is not a quadratic equation. (iii) `x(2x+3) = x^2+1` `=>2x^2+3x = x^2+1` `=>x^2+3x-1 = 0` As coefficient of `x^2` is not `0`, so it is a quadratic equation. (iv) `(x+2)^3 = x^3-4` `=>x^3+2^3+3(2)(x)(x+2) = x^3-4` `=>x^3+8+6x^2+12x = x^3-4` `=>6x^2+12x+12 = 0` `=>x^2+2x+2 = 0` As coefficient of `x^2` is not `0`, so it is a quadratic equation. |
